Not sure what you're looking for when you ask about the difference between an MT and an AT. Of course, there is the obvious.. one is a manual and one is an automatic. Manuals come standard with Brembos up front, larger rotors, stiffer springs and shocks, and larger sway bars. And yes, there is a noticable difference in the handling between a manual and an automatic. I should know.. I have one of each. Mine is an '04 manual and my wife's is an '05 automatic.

Manuals run the quarter mile quicker, too. However, the automatic is no slouch. Excellent throttle response coupled with a minimum amount of "slush" feeling in first gear make the automatic "touchy".. which is a good thing.

These are good cars and great fun to drive and own. You won't be sorry.
